Diaper donors get circus tickets


Staff report

Youngstown

Making Kids Count is in critical need of diapers for its diaper bank, and Feld Entertainment, producer of Ringling Bros. and Barnum & Bailey, will help the organization by hosting a diaper drive Saturday from 10 a.m. to noon at Covelli Centre.

Families who bring an unopened package of disposable diapers will receive a free ticket voucher to see Ringling Bros. and Barnum & Bailey Circus presents “Legends,” which comes to Covelli April 25 to 28.

The vouchers may be redeemed for any performance. There will be a limit of 350 vouchers available, and a limit of two ticket vouchers per donating family.

“Making Kids Count distributes more than 4,000 diapers each month to agencies throughout Mahoning Valley,” said Jana Coffin, co-president. “Our goal is to collect at least a month supply of diapers during the drive with Ringling Bros. and Barnum & Bailey.”

In conjunction with the diaper drive, Ringling Bros. and Barnum & Bailey hopes to remind people of its Baby’s First Circus program, which invites audience members under one year of age to attend the circus for free. Details and application information are available at ringling.com.
